A question about : Beware debit card charges if buying currency at Debenhams

Be warned, Debenhams make a hidden charge when you use your debit card in store. I recently purchased Euros having gone through the tool on here and printed the voucher. In-store I presented this and my debit card, never expecting to be charged for using this form of payment.
Only later when checking my account did I find a separate deduction for this transaction, effectively a 2% surcharge.

So basically they are absolving themselves of any responsibility.

I am particularly annoyed as this surcharge is not flagged in any way, nor is it shown on the receipt. You only find out about it when you see the debit on your bank statement. I have looked at their T&C's too, again no mention is made. It's a bit shocking to realise companies can be so underhand.

Since then I have gone back over previous bank statements and found I was similarly charged on two occassions last year, so it's a long-term stealth charge.

I'm not dropping this, but feel others should be aware.
